Cooler compatibility with socket LGA 1700

Intercor

Hey everybody i a have a question, is the new socket that brands provide enough for the new lga 1700 or the cooling base that its in contact with the cpu have to be longer, because i have a coolermaster 410r and i dont know if with the new socket it would be enough to cool the 12400, should i put it on or buy a new one?

Most coolers out right now won't cover the entire IHS, and that's fine. Do you have the LGA 1700 mounts for your cooler? 1700 does take new mounting hardware.

 

Cooler Master's Cooler Compatibility List (According to this list your cooler will require new hardware to mount to 1700)

 

It will be an acceptable cooler if you already own it. Better than the OEM cooler. I wouldn't buy a new one, unless you are looking to upgrade.
